Slizewski sizzles in Pure Stock action, Zdroik captures A-Mod win!
By Don Scharf

August 14, 2001; Eagle River, WI. - Coca-Cola night at the races featured some great racing under clear skies at Riverside Raceway in Eagle River, Tuesday, August 14th.

In heat one of the Bandits, Dan Zelton took over after lap two to take the win while Phil Malouf and Bruce Belland were side by side for the last few laps with Malouf prevailing and Belland settling for third. Jason Shattuck and Tim Rosemark ran away from the pack to finish one-two respectively in the second heat of the Bandits. Rod Rodziczak finished third.

Dan Melton led the first Pure Stock heat until a spin sent him to the back. Brian Slizewski took over until Vic Bodamer got by him and held on for the win with Slizewski second and Tom Nolda third. In the Pure Stock second heat Chad Rosinski led most of the way until a steering problem sent him into the wall and onto his trailer. Jeremy Melton, who was running in second ended up with a flat and Marlys Scharf got by Keith Durand for the win. Durand was second and Jim Melton was third.

In the first Street Stock heat Dennis Lacrosse held off Fritz Scharf for the win with Scharf second and Joe St Germain third. Heat two saw Ken Valeria take the lead on lap four from Mike Boyd and proceeded to run away with it. Boyd finished second and Ryan Glembin third.

Tad Schoonover led the First Miller Lite A-Mod heat from flag to flag. Mark Albertus got by Scott Blamberg on the last lap to finish second. Heat two had Ken Smith lead early but gave way to Stan Rychlock. Heavy contact on the last lap between the Tom Zdroik and Rychlock saw Zdroik come out on top for the win with Rychlock second and Guy Carly third.

After intermission, the Pure Stocks came to the line. Chad Belland took over the lead from Dan Melton after a few laps. Brian Slizewski took over second from Bodamer on lap seven and hounded Belland until Belland spun in corner four giving Slizewski the lead. A caution due to a fire on Dan Melton's car ended the race as time had expired. Slizewski was declared the winner with Keith Durand second and Chad Belland third.

Mike Boyd led the Street Stock feature until Ken Valeria passed him on the last lap for the win with Boyd finishing second and LaCrosse third.

The next feature of the night was the Bandits. Phil Malouf led the first ten laps. Belland got by him for the win with Malouf taking second and Zelton third.

Kenny Smith and Mark Albertus swapped the lead a few times early in the Miller Lite A-Mod feature. Tom Zdroik who was never far behind took advantage of several yellows and lots of broken equipment to edge by Tad Schoonover for the win. Schoonover finished second and Guy Carly third.

Thad Boettcher edged out Ann Chapman for the win in the Street Eliminator class.
